
UGI Corporation held its fiscal Q2 2026 earnings call, with management stating the year is 'shaping up to be a year of meaningful progress' against strategic priorities. The excerpt provided is mostly introductory and forward-looking disclaimer language, with no specific financial results, guidance figures, or notable surprises disclosed yet. The tone is neutral and informational, typical of an earnings-call opening.
The setup here is less about the quarter itself and more about whether management can convert a slow, utility-like re-rating into a credible self-help story. In this name, multiple compression typically persists until investors see a cleaner path to debt reduction and a narrower earnings dispersion across segments; absent that, good quarterly execution alone tends to fade quickly. The most important second-order effect is that any improvement in operating consistency can lower the company’s cost of equity faster than headline growth can change the intrinsic story. From a competitive lens, the key question is whether peers with simpler structures and cleaner cash flow visibility continue to steal the multiple. If UGI can demonstrate that capital allocation is finally subordinated to balance-sheet repair, it can close some of that valuation gap; if not, the market will keep treating it as a “prove it” story and reward only incremental de-leveraging. That creates a very asymmetric setup around guidance revisions: modest upward changes in free-cash-flow trajectory could matter more than earnings beats. The contrarian view is that the market may be underestimating how much operating leverage sits below the surface in a depressed multiple name once sentiment turns. In a low-expectation environment, even a small improvement in execution can trigger a multi-quarter rerating because short interest and passive underownership amplify the move. The downside catalyst is equally simple: any sign that improvement is being financed by working-capital timing or non-recurring items would quickly cap upside and re-anchor the stock at a distressed-quality multiple.
